Saw these at WM and decided to splurge, since I was due to replace wiper blades soon. Brand new, latest and greatest beam blade from Michelin, silicone, lasts 2 million wipes, plus water-repellancy like the Rain-X wipers, etc.
https://michelinmedia.com/pages/blog/detail/article/c0/a910/
If all that is close to true, it will be worth the $41 I paid. My personal record for wipers, which will last a long time. (Both the wipers and the record.) Put them on in the parking lot, ran them 5 minutes on a clear dry windshield as the instructions say, tested them with washer fluid a few times. Great so far. Rain tomorrow. We shall see.
